We Got Fireballed

Yesterday we put up our post about the Investment Rating of all 31 Major League Baseball teams after factoring in their final salaries. It was a post we worked on late into the night for and we were pretty proud of it considering just a few posts before it we were making puns about Pam from the Office’s vagina. Later on yesterday you may have seen the site be…a little slow. [Read More]